The Logitech Formula Force EX is quite good for its price.
The only problem I had with it is the shifters, button-like shifters instead of paddles. :confused: Not as comfortable as paddle shifters. |

The springs don't have much resistance so it takes almost no effort to press down the pedals. They are made of plastic so I guess they can break if you're too rough with them. You get used to the pedals after some time. I had my Driving Force for 3 years (same pedals as on the Formula Force EX), never had problems with them. |
